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| African Penduline-Tit | Huashen Pseudomoustache Toad |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Passeriformes (Songbirds)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Remizidae | Megophryidae |
| Genus | Anthoscopus | Leptobrachium |
| Species | Anthoscopus caroli | Leptobrachium huashen |
